About this position
Air Force Institute of Technology (AFIT), Department of Operational Sciences, is inviting applications for a tenure-track or tenured faculty position in Logistics & Supply Chain Management at the Assistant, Associate, or Full Professor rank.
The role is based at Wright-Patterson AFB in Dayton, Ohio, and is aimed at candidates with expertise in logistics, supply chain management, operations management, or closely related disciplines. The posting highlights research and teaching interests in contested logistics, resilient and adaptive supply chains, and AI/business analytics for operational decision-making.
Faculty responsibilities include graduate teaching, course and curriculum development, supervision of master's and doctoral students, applied research, scholarly publication, and service to the department and institute. AFIT emphasizes impactful research tied to real operational and defense-related challenges and offers the opportunity to work with graduate students in a highly applied environment.
Funding/salary: The USAJobs announcement lists a salary range of $75,469 to $209,600 per year (AD-22 to AD-24). The position is full-time and may include additional salary support through faculty-obtained research funding after the first two years.
Eligibility: U.S. citizenship is required. The announcement also notes standard federal employment conditions and a security/background investigation. Applicants are encouraged to select AD-22 as the lowest acceptable grade to be eligible for the AD-22/23/24 certificate.
Application window: This is an open continuous announcement. The initial cut-off date is 2026-03-01, with additional cut-offs every 30 days. The announcement remains open until 2026-06-30.
How to apply: Apply through USAJobs and submit a complete application before the relevant cut-off date. If you are specifically interested in Logistics & Supply Chain Management, clearly indicate that in your application materials.
